Abstract

Most object-oriented analysis and design methodogies are based on structured analysis and information modeling and are using for intuitive analysis and design models based on object-oriented programming languages. Therefore there are many problems such as when a system is implemented incorrect semantics and inconsistency between models.This paper submits a decomposition and design method for object, dynamic and functional module of the methodology of a new system development life-cycle. Thus, we present a new system development life cycle, and suggests a object-oriented design method and standards of module decomposition for the decomposition of object, dynamic, fuctional models due to object-oriented design procedures and specifications This proposed method enables developers to reflect user''s software requirements conveniently.We prove the validity and practicality of this object-oriented design method through implementing a real-system.
